NN1177 (NNC9204-1177) TFA is a long-acting GLP-1/glucagon receptor co-agonist. NN1177 TFA can induce a dose-dependent body weight loss in diet-induced obese (DIO) mice.

NN1177 (0.75-4 nmol/kg, s.c., once daily, 8 weeks) TFA reduces liver fat and inflammatory and fibrosis relevant biomarkers in C57Bl/6 mice fed a fructose and high fat rich diet (NASH model)[2].

Synonyms
NNC9204-1177 TFA
-
Sequence
His-{Aib}-Gln-Gly-Thr-Phe-Thr-Ser-Asp-Leu-Ser-Lys-Tyr-Leu-Glu-Ser-Lys-Arg-Ala-Arg-Glu-Phe-Val-Gln-Trp-Leu-Leu-{Lys(gGlu-gGlu-Ser-Glu-Ser-gGlu-gGlu-C18 diacid)}-Thr-NH2
-
Sequence Shortening
H-{Aib}-QGTFTSDLSKYLESKRAREFVQWLL-{Lys(γGlu-γGlu-Ser-Glu-Ser-γGlu-γGlu-C18 diacid)}-T-NH2
